I'm looking into updating my Catalog backup to use the bpipe plugin, but I don't seem to be able to get my PluginDirectory correctly defined. I keep getting failures like this one:
21-Dec 08:28 babylon4-dir JobId 609: shell command: run BeforeJob "/opt/bacula/sbin/checkhost babylon4" 21-Dec 08:28 babylon4-dir JobId 609: Start Backup JobId 609, Job=Catalog_Backup.2009-12-21_08.28.45_05 21-Dec 08:28 babylon4-dir JobId 609: Using Device "FileStorage" 21-Dec 08:28 babylon4 JobId 609: Fatal error: Plugin Directory not defined. Cannot use plugin: " 21-Dec 08:28 babylon4 JobId 609: Fatal error: Failed to authenticate Storage daemon. 21-Dec 08:28 babylon4-dir JobId 609: Fatal error: Bad response to Storage command: wanted 2000 OK storage , got 2902 Bad storage Can anyone give me any pointers on WHERE to correctly define PluginDirectory?
